Sustainable and efficient: QUANTUM G

Eco-friendly refrigerants are future-proof: the EU’s new F-Gas Regulation prescribes a reduction in the use of environmentally harmful gases. QUANTUM G uses the refrigerant R-1234ze, which has an atmospheric lifetime of just 18 days and achieves an impressively low GWP* value of less than 1 (*GWP = Global Warming). Not only that, it is compact and versatile, with a capacity range of 300 to 7,500 kW.

Your benefits

QUANTUM G

  • Compact chiller for inside installation
  • Meets all current environmental requirements
  • Very small ecological footprint
  • High recooling temperatures
  • In addition: all advantages of QUANTUM X
